Margaret Elizabeth Anderson , also known as Boney or Lou, was born July 28, 1947, in Louisa, Virginia to the late Walter Mallory and Angie Anderson Mallory (Melton). Margaret gained her heavenly wings on December 7, 2023, at the University of Virginia Hospital in Charlottesville, Virginia. Along with her parents, she was preceded in death by her brother, Richard Anderson, her nephew, Travis Mallory and great-niece D'Monet Anderson.
She attended Louisa County Public Schools and graduated from A.G. Richardson High School in 1965. After graduating from high school, she worked several jobs: Mineral Manufacturing, Lawda Industries, Supervisor at Best Products for over 25 years in Ashland, and Supervisor at McKesson Medical in Richmond where she retired in 2016. After retirement, she worked for Louisa County Public School Transportation Department until her health began to decline. She was a member of the A.G. Richardson Alumni Committee for several years.
Margaret was baptized at an early age at Ebenezer Baptist Church and was an active member. She attended Sunday school and church services regularly. She was a member of the Trustee Ministry, a member of the Missionary Ministry, and a member and President of the Gospel Chorus until her health began to decline. Her favorite scripture was Psalm 23.
She enjoyed life by spending time with her family and friends. She loved reading, doing word searches and word puzzles, playing Bingo, watching her game and cooking shows: especially Press Your Luck, Hell's Kitchen, and her westerns - Gunsmoke and Big Valley. She also enjoyed watching Judge Judy. If you ever got the chance to grace her presence, you would never forget her.
